Job Responsibilities
Your day-to-day work will focus on execution quality across digital platforms.
Core Functions
-
Schedule and publish approved content across social media platforms with accuracy and consistency
-
Maintain up-to-date posting calendars and ensure deadlines are met
-
Update website content, including product/service details, pricing, and announcements
-
Conduct regular audits of digital assets to ensure accuracy, consistency, and compliance
Collaboration & Communication
-
Coordinate with internal teams to receive finalized content and clear instructions
-
Maintain organized records of updates, postings, and change logs
-
Flag inconsistencies, missing information, or content errors to management quickly
-
Ensure every update aligns with brand standards across platforms
Performance, Reporting & Tools Management
-
Manage CMS platforms and social media scheduling tools
-
Conduct quality checks for formatting, links, and brand compliance
-
Update product listings, prices, and descriptions across online platforms and directories
-
Monitor and report any system or workflow issues that affect publishing and updates

1) What does a Marketing Operations Specialist do day-to-day?
They schedule and publish content, update website product/pricing information, maintain calendars, audit digital assets, and ensure every update is accurate and brand-compliant.
2) Is this role available remotely?
Yes, the role can be Dubai or Remote, depending on the candidate, but you must be available during UAE working hours.
3) What is the salary for this job in Dubai?
The posting lists a monthly salary range of AED 3,000 – AED 4,000, along with visa sponsorship and medical insurance.
4) Do I need advanced marketing strategy experience?
No. This is an operational and administrative role focused on execution accuracy, CMS updates, scheduling, and process.
5) What tools should I know for marketing operations?
CMS platforms and social scheduling tools are core. Familiarity with online marketplace listing tools is a plus, and strong attention to detail is essential.
